Newscast producer vs newscast director

The differences between newscast producers and newscast directors can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. While it typically takes 6-12 months to become a newscast producer, becoming a newscast director takes usually requires 1-2 years. Additionally, a newscast director has an average salary of $54,603, which is higher than the $50,394 average annual salary of a newscast producer.

The top three skills for a newscast producer include control room, story development and edit video. The most important skills for a newscast director are control room, GRASS, and ENPS.
